PROJECT OVERVIEW![]()
Newfoundland and Labrador Refining Corporation announced on February 08, 2006 that it has begun a feasibility study concerning a potential new oil refinery in Placentia Bay, Newfoundland and Labrador, Canada. The feasibility study is timely because of limited oil refining capacity worldwide and strong market demand for refined petroleum products. The feasibility study area in Placentia Bay has been selected because it is a strategic location that offers natural competitive advantages over locations in the world being considered by others in the refining industry. In addition, the province of Newfoundland and Labrador has encouraged and promoted the building of new oil refining capacity in the province. |
